MINNEAPOLIS — Breanna Stewart sat on the bench within the fourth quarter of Sport 3 within the WNBA Finals on Wednesday, her staff down two factors. The New York Liberty had clawed again from a 15-point first-quarter deficit, largely due to an outstanding 30-point night time from Stewart.
Earlier than the Liberty returned to the ground towards the house staff Lynx and their 19,521 followers desperate to see Minnesota return to its championship glory, Stewart emphatically delivered a easy message earlier than the timeout ended.
“We aren’t going to f—ing lose this sport.”
“I might really feel it,” Stewart mentioned of the second. “You may really feel the momentum was shifting to our facet. It [was] like, if we’re going to be this shut, we’re not leaving right here with out this win.”
The Liberty introduced Stewart’s plea into fruition.
Behind 11 factors within the closing 2:10 from Sabrina Ionescu and Jonquel Jones — capped by Ionescu’s 28-foot 3-pointer to win the sport — New York secured a 80-77 comeback victory to maneuver inside one win of clinching the 2024 WNBA title.

And whereas Ionescu’s closing shot could be the lasting picture from the sport, the Liberty — who’re chasing the franchise’s first championship — would have been on life assist with out Stewart’s monster night time on each ends of the ground.
The 2-time WNBA, four-time NCAA champion and two-time WNBA MVP completed with 30 factors, 11 rebounds and 4 blocks, making her the one participant in league historical past with a number of 30-10 Finals performances. She can be the one participant to have a 30-point Finals sport for 2 completely different franchises, her earlier one coming with the Seattle Storm.
“We do not win this sport with out Stewie,” Ionescu mentioned. “What she was capable of do, simply continued to chip away … that [game-winning] shot’s good however that does not go towards what she’s been capable of do for us tonight and the way she was capable of simply will us again into that sport.”
“She carried us,” Jones added of Stewart. “With out her, we would not be able to make these large performs.”
This 12 months’s WNBA Finals have been a curler coaster for Stewart and the Liberty. In Sport 1, New York blew a 15-point edge with 5 minutes to go earlier than shedding in additional time. Stewart missed what would have been the game-winning free throw with 0.8 left in regulation, in addition to a layup in additional time that will have tied the rating proper earlier than the ultimate buzzer.
Behind Stewart’s 21-point, 5-steal outing, the Liberty bounced again in Sport 2. However in Minnesota’s first residence sport of the collection, New York received punched first, struggling early towards the Lynx’s defensive stress and committing 8 first-quarter turnovers. Minnesota turned these into 14 factors to assist construct a double-digit benefit.
Stewart began heating up within the second interval with six factors, serving to New York lower the deficit to a manageable eight going into the break. However she put her foot on the gasoline after halftime: With a pair of 3-pointers, some robust soar photographs and a number of and-1s, Stewart scored 13 straight factors for the Liberty throughout the third and fourth intervals, tying the rating and marking probably the most consecutive staff factors scored by a single participant within the WNBA Finals.
Her 22 factors within the second half had been the fourth most by a participant in both half in Finals historical past.
“She made large, large performs and had a giant stretch,” Liberty guard Courtney Vandersloot mentioned. “After we could not actually rating, she received a number of large buckets, sort of received our offense going. … That is what you count on your superstars to do.”
Stewart’s effort on the defensive finish was simply as impactful. Along with her rim safety — three of her 4 blocks got here within the second half — Stewart held the Lynx to 4-for-15 taking pictures as a main defender and compelled 4 turnovers. Over the previous two video games, Lynx star Napheesa Collier has shot 4-for-12 and dedicated six turnovers towards Stewart.
“You simply see her expertise, proper? She’s a tremendous participant,” New York guard Leonie Fiebich mentioned. “Simply on offense and protection she made such large performs for us. By no means gave up. She was all the time coming in, flying from someplace on the defensive finish. It was nice to look at her carry out like that.”

Sport 3 mirrored Sport 1: The street staff erased a giant deficit — final Thursday, Minnesota trailed by as many as 18 — to return away with the victory. Since that heartbreaking defeat, Stewart and the Liberty “had been all sort of simply ready for our second, ready for the script to flip somewhat bit,” she mentioned.
“I used to be motivated,” Stewart mentioned about Wednesday’s contest. “I used to be mad [that New York was losing]. And I favored my matchups that I had, and actually sort of attacking them to be sure that we might get this again into the place we wanted to be for it to be a ballgame.”
With another win, Stewart can carry the Liberty the championship she envisioned when she signed with the staff in free company forward of the 2023 season. She will be able to absolutely exorcise any demons remaining from how 2023 ended — a 3-for-17 Sport 4 efficiency because the Las Vegas Aces celebrated the WNBA title on the Liberty’s residence ground. And if New York wins Friday (8 p.m. ET, ESPN) or in a decisive Sport 5 on Sunday, Stewart might turn into solely the second WNBA participant, and first since Cynthia Cooper, to win a minimum of three Finals MVPs.
However the glory of what might lie forward was of no concern to Stewart after Wednesday’s sport. The job is not carried out but, she reiterated.
“We all know we’re one sport away from successful the championship, and I believe that they will give us their greatest shot,” Stewart mentioned. “They will give every thing they’ve, and you understand what, so are we.”
